Output 75aacfc33129ad7b962f3feccb4297dcb0db7ee177b469fa86cd3eb95c8cfa59:1

value
2258600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93a34fb88dee4253091decc9604b3e1669e18486 OP_EQUALVERIFY OP_CHECKSIG
address
1ETdyGwGpDrBzHro37935pwpzCBTeuHaYw
transaction
75aacfc33129ad7b962f3feccb4297dcb0db7ee177b469fa86cd3eb95c8cfa59
spent
true